Output ef80a5a7a86063f6c5b17dced954dc66a75071f8c852c0aae00731044381f217:0

value
604779999
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 308dafdafa84b06169cf9a7922e092adee35909c OP_EQUALVERIFY OP_CHECKSIG
address
15RjAnkBR61Dpg5irrTRKU8f5uKNpaNxRJ
transaction
ef80a5a7a86063f6c5b17dced954dc66a75071f8c852c0aae00731044381f217
spent
true